Elon Musk, James Franco refuse to go to court to help Amber Heard

AmericaBillionaire Elon Musk and actor James Franco withdraw from the list of witnesses to help Amber Heard in the case with Johnny Depp.

According to NY Post, The two stars will not appear in court in Fairfax as planned to give testimony. Elon Musk’s lawyer Alex Spiro confirmed the information. A source close to James Franco also said that the actor did not want to be involved in the incident between Heard and Depp.

At the end of March, the source of People said Musk and Franco accepted to stand trial in support of Amber Heard. In the lawsuit, Depp once said Heard had an affair with Tesla’s billionaire. Actor Pirates of the Caribbean said that his ex-wife started dating Musk only a month after the two got married, ie early 2015. During the trial on April 21, Johnny Depp also said he suspected Heard had an affair with James Franco during the time the two were still together. are husband and wife.

The Tesla boss’s representative denied the information in Depp’s lawsuit. Musk’s side said that he had known Heard for a long time, but only dated at the end of 2016. The two broke up after a year because they were too busy with their own projects. In an interview with Rolling Stones In 2017, Musk said it was painful to end his relationship with the actress. Amber Heard and James Franco also denied the allegations.

During the trial on April 28, a series of Johnny Depp’s witnesses gave testimony against Amber Heard.

Terence Dougherty – director of the nonprofit organization American Civil Liberties Union (ACLU) – was the first to appear in court. He confirmed Amber Heard did not spend all of the compensation from the divorce with Depp to the charity as promised. The actress said she would donate $3.5 million over 10 years, starting with a donation of $350,000 in 2016. In 2019, the organization contacted her to remind them of their promise. Heard said he could not continue to donate due to financial reasons.

Thereafter, the ACLU received three more funds from organizations and individuals deposited on behalf of Heard. Dougherty revealed that Depp paid his ex-wife $ 100,000, two amounts of $ 500,000 and $ 350,000 were sent from anonymous funds. Dougherty believes that the benefactor who secretly donated $500,000 is billionaire Elon Musk, Amber Heard’s ex-boyfriend. However, he did not give specific evidence in court.

After the lunch break, Edward White – Depp’s business manager – went to court. He recounted the process of negotiating divorce terms between the stars. Amber Heard repeatedly demanded that her husband increase his compensation, from $4 million to $7 million. Depp also had to pay $500,000 in attorney fees for her. Heard also requested access to Depp’s several cars and three Los Angeles penthouses. In return, the actress side promised to keep quiet about the divorce, not to disclose information to the media.

Malcolm Connolly – Depp’s bodyguard – said through a pre-recorded video that Amber Heard always wanted to be the breadwinner, making important decisions in the family. He said he discovered Depp had many bruises on his face and neck around 2015. In contrast, the bodyguard said he had never seen Heard show signs of abuse while working for both. Connolly also admitted to repeatedly seeing Depp use drugs for pleasure.

Starling Jenkins – Depp’s driver – said he witnessed Amber Heard using psychedelic mushrooms while going to the Coachella music festival. He also recounted a time when the actress threw Depp’s phone and credit card out the window after an argument. Amber Heard’s attorney denied the doping charges, saying Jenkins mistook Amber for her sister, Whitney.

Amber Heard’s lawyer said that the testimony in the trial on April 28 was subjective because it came from loyal employees of Johnny Depp. The court will resume the adversarial sessions early next week. Johnny Depp and Amber Heard have been dating since filming together The Rum Diary (2011), got married in February 2015. Fifteen months after their wedding, Heard filed a lawsuit in court asking for the right to ban Johnny from approaching and accusing him of verbally and violently abusing her. Depp countered that he was the one being abused by his wife. The two sides argued and talked bad about each other for months before completing the case divorce 2016.

Things gradually subsided before Amber Heard Write a letter in a magazine Washington Post at the end of 2018 accused of being abused by Depp. The actor denied and said his ex-wife made up stories to promote the movie Aquaman. He sued her in US court for defamation and demanded $50 million in damages. Heard then counter-sued Depp for the same crime, demanding $100 million in damages.
